   Gumboots with two pairs of socks (one thick) and her feet will be fine    You can hire snow suits etc from the mountain or any of the rental places.
 They are pretty cheap, about $10-15 and worth it if you're only going up once a year.

   Yeah we just hired ours for the kids and like Meow said, it was really cheap. About $35 for both kids for 2 days hire and they were the proper warm, waterproof ones. 
I didn't think it was worth buying because by the time we went back to the snow again they'd have outgrown them anyway.
 We did buy gloves and hats and sunnies for them though, and like Meow, gumboots with lots of socks (and spare ones in the car too) worked a treat.
